Eric Pearson Englund age 83, passed away in the early morning of December 31st 2008. Eric was born on September 26th in the year of 1925 to parents Olga and Eric Englund of Swedish and Finnish decent. Eric graduated from Lake Meridian High School and lived in the Kent\/Renton area his entire life. He attended the University of Washington where he studied architecture and was a member of Phi Kappa Psi. Eric married Lois Jean Buck on the 17th of March in the year 1950. Eric retired from the Post office in 1984 after thirty one years of civil service. Eric, like his father, was a brilliant woodworker\/carpenter and built much of the house that he lived in for most of his life. Eric also enjoyed playing golf and played regularly for many years after his retirement. Eric was preceded in death by son Ric and granddaughter Jennifer Brinkman.
